Abstract

The utility model discloses a machine case mechanism that puts on shelf fast, including stand and guide rail group, guide rail group sets up in two between the stand, wherein, guide rail group is including inner rail and outer rail, the inner rail is fixed in quick -witted case both sides, the both ends of outer rail pass through connecting portion with the stand is fixed, connecting portion insert fix in the through -hole of stand. Above -mentioned machine case mechanism that puts on shelf fast, it is fixed with the stand that connecting portion are passed through at the both ends of outer rail, and installation promptly finished in connecting portion inserted the through -hole of stand, avoided the screw fixation, and simple to operate, expense are low, and the dismouting the tool operation is exempted from to the outer rail, and the practicality is good, the dismouting is nimble.

Description

A kind of quick get-on carriage mechanism of cabinet
Technical field
The utility model relates to a kind of rack, especially a kind of quick get-on carriage mechanism of cabinet.
Background technology
Rack generally is used to deposit the noon of computer and related control device, it is provided that to the protection of storage equipment. At present, it is necessary to the machine of upper rack adopts the mode of mounting guide rail or pallet to fix usually. Installing conventional guide rails to need to be screwed interior rail alignment rack open holes, operation easier is greatly, costly; Pallet is installed costly, and tray area big, cannot move flexibly, weak heat-dissipating. It is thus desirable to a kind of cabinet get-on carriage mechanism can realize installing simple and quick, flexible and convenient to use.
Practical novel content
The purpose of this utility model is to propose a kind of quick get-on carriage mechanism of cabinet, by improving the installation mode of set of rails, reduces the added installation difficulty of cabinet and expense, and set of rails uses flexibly.
For reaching this object, the utility model by the following technical solutions:
A kind of quick get-on carriage mechanism of cabinet, comprise column and set of rails, described set of rails is arranged at described in two between column, wherein, described set of rails comprises the interior rail and outer rail that cooperatively interact, described interior rail is fixed on cabinet both sides, and the two ends of described outer rail are fixed by connection section and described column, and described connection section inserts in the through hole of described column and is fixed.
Wherein, described connection section comprises web plate and is arranged at the connecting joint of described web plate side, and one end of described web plate is connected with the end of described outer rail, and described connecting joint cross section is L-type and extends to two ends along described web plate.
Wherein, the inner side of described connecting joint is provided with shell fragment, and described shell fragment is concordant with connecting joint, described shell fragment and the laminating of described connection section.
Wherein, the afterbody of described shell fragment is provided with for spacing clamp, and described clamp is sheathed on outside described connection section.
Wherein, the end of described shell fragment is provided with dop, and described dop is the projection being perpendicular to described shell fragment.
Wherein, the other end of described web plate is provided with the baffle plate being perpendicular to described web plate, and described baffle plate is between described connecting joint.
Wherein, being provided with middle rail between described interior rail and outer rail, described middle rail can block and realizes running fit into described interior rail, described outer rail and middle rail running fit, and described interior rail, middle rail and outer rail between any two all can relatively sliding.
Wherein, slotted hole offered by described outer rail, and the spacing card on described middle rail is arranged in described slotted hole.
Wherein, the through hole on described column is square hole, and described column is evenly provided with a row square hole from top to bottom.
A kind of quick get-on carriage mechanism of cabinet described in the utility model, the two ends of described outer rail are fixed by connection section and described column, described connection section inserts in the through hole of described column and namely installs, exempt screw to fix, easy for installation, expense is low, and dismount described outer rail exempt from instrument operation, practicality is good, dismounting is flexible.

Embodiment
Below in conjunction with accompanying drawing and by embodiment, the technical solution of the utility model is described further.
As Figure 1-Figure 4, a kind of quick get-on carriage mechanism of cabinet described in the present embodiment, a kind of quick get-on carriage mechanism of cabinet, comprising column 1 and set of rails 2, described set of rails 2 is arranged between two described columns 1, wherein, described set of rails 2 comprises the interior rail 21 and outer rail 23 that cooperatively interact, described interior rail 21 is fixed on cabinet both sides, and the two ends of described outer rail 23 are fixed by connection section 3 and described column 1, and described connection section 3 inserts in the square hole 11 of described column 1 and is fixed.
Described connection section 3 comprises web plate 31 and is arranged at the connecting joint 32 of described web plate 31 side, and one end of described web plate 31 is connected with the end of described outer rail 23, and described connecting joint 32 cross section is L-type and extends to two ends along described web plate 31; The inner side of described connecting joint 32 is provided with shell fragment 4, and described shell fragment 4 is concordant with connecting joint 32, and described shell fragment 4 is fitted with described connection section 3; The other end of described web plate 31 is provided with the baffle plate 33 being perpendicular to described web plate 31, and described baffle plate 33 is between described connecting joint 32; The end of described shell fragment 4 is provided with dop 41, and described dop 41 is for being perpendicular to the projection of described shell fragment 4; Inserted by described connecting joint 32 in the square hole 11 of described column 1 with shell fragment 4, the dop 41 of described shell fragment 4 supports residence state column 1 through described square hole 11, described baffle plate 33, described connection section 3 is fixedly connected with column 1 and avoids relatively sliding.
The afterbody of described shell fragment 4 is provided with for spacing clamp 5, and described clamp 5 is sheathed on outside described connection section 3; After described shell fragment 4 blocks described square hole 11, promoting described clamp 5 forward, conflicting the afterbody of described shell fragment 4 in the rear end of described clamp 5, blocks tight described shell fragment 4 restriction retraction.
Being provided with middle rail 22 between described interior rail 21 and outer rail 23, described middle rail 22 can block into described interior rail 21 running fit, described outer rail 23 and middle rail 22 running fit, and described interior rail 21, middle rail 22, outer rail 23 can relatively sliding; Slotted hole 231 offered by described outer rail 23, is provided with the spacing card 221 of described middle rail 22 in described slotted hole 231; Regulate the spacing card 221 of described middle rail 22 to limit the sliding distance of described outer rail 23, thus regulate the installation length of described outer rail 23 to adapt to the rack of different size.
Described column 1 is evenly provided with a row square hole 11 from top to bottom; Described outer rail 23 installs different described square holes 11 to regulate the mounting height of cabinet.
The quick get-on carriage mechanism of cabinet described in the present embodiment has the following advantages: 1, outer rail 23 is directly blocked by connection section 3 in the square hole 11 of column 1 and is fixed, and exempts screw and fixes, easy for installation, expense is low; 2, the dop 41 of shell fragment 4 blocks in square hole 11, pushes away and blocks tight shell fragment 4 into clamp 5, and the baffle plate of connection section 3 33 supports column 1, column 1 and outer rail 23 is connected firmly, reliably; 3, interior rail 21 is directly fixed on cabinet, pushes away and can fix cabinet into outer rail 23, dismounts flexible, easy to use; 4, outer rail 23 and middle rail 22 coordinate the installation length that can regulate outer rail 23, adapt to the rack of different size, and versatility is good.
